ORDER NUMBER

G-195-16

 

IN THE MATTER OF

the Utilities Commission Act, RSBC 1996, Chapter 473

 

and

 

the Insurance Corporation Act, RSBC 1996, Chapter 228, as amended

 

and

 

Insurance Corporation of British Columbia

An Application for Approval of the Revenue Requirements for Universal Compulsory Automobile Insurance

Effective November 1, 2016

 

BEFORE:

D. A. Cote, Commissioner/Panel Chair

B. A. Magnan, Commissioner

R. I. Mason, Commissioner

 

on December 20, 2016

 

ORDER

WHEREAS:

 

A.      On August 25, 2016, the Insurance Corporation of British Columbia (ICBC) filed an application to the British Columbia Utilities Commission (Commission) for its 2016 Revenue Requirements for Universal Compulsory Automobile Insurance (Basic insurance), seeking a Basic insurance rate increase of 4.9 percent for the policy year commencing November 1, 2016 (PY 2016) (Application);

B.      By Orders G-142-16 and G-163-16, among other matters, the Commission established a regulatory timetable for the review of the Application and approved a Basic rate increase of 4.9 percent on an interim basis for PY 2016, pending approval of a permanent rate;

C.      On December 19, 2016, the Lieutenant Governor in Council issued Order in Council No. 960, amending Special Direction IC2 to the British Columbia Utilities Commission (Special Direction IC2), which adds that for the PY 2016, the Commission must issue its final general rate change order by January 16, 2017 and the PY 2016 rate change must not exceed 4.9 percent (OIC 960/16); and

D.      The Commission considers that suspending the Regulatory Timetable established by Order G-163-16 is warranted due to the requirements set out in OIC 960/16.

 

NOW THEREFORE the British Columbia Utilities Commission orders that the regulatory timetable established under Order G-163-16 is suspended. The Commission will issue an amended regulatory timetable in due course.
